We Bury the Dead was an interesting watch. With what felt like few zombie scares came a really good story about someone looking for someone they lost and how they found them. While the scares that were in the movie were effective and flowed well with the story, there were very few it felt like even for a runtime of 95 minutes.
Got an early screening of We Bury the Dead for the Regal Mystery Movie. The trailer makes it look like an exciting zombie drama. But it certainly is NOT. The zombies are background noise.
Positives!
+Daisy Ridley and Brenton Thwaites do a good job with the script.
+Good Zombie design.
+Using zombies as an allegory for loss and grief is a good idea.
Negatives!
-No explanation is given for anything. Not the explosion, the zombies, nothing.
-Trailer is a bait and switch.
-Surface level drama.
-Zombies offer nothing to the story.
Honestly, this film should have been a miniseries. Then it could have explored all the missing details from the film. If the zombie angle was removed, the film would be nearly identical. Thats how little they matter. If you want a surface level drama about cheating spouses, check it out. If you're looking for zombie action, keep moving.
